HOME RUN (c) Copyright 2009

Sixty seconds and counting
The tension is mounting
Crowd on their feet
Announcers don't miss a beat


It's going, going...
1st base, quickening pace
Around the bend to 2nd place


Going...
3rd in sight
One with the wind and taking flight


Gone...
And the crowd goes wild
It's out of the park!
No foul


It's pandemonium in the dome
As Player of the Day slides into home.


(c) Copyright 2009 Melanie D. West
